Age | Commit message (Collapse) | Author | Files | Lines |
|
|
|
fix authetication issue in scenario page
add tests
Change-Id: I5d1457c4fde7c803459352223b1dfb2f970212df
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
User can add multiple customs by giving a
comma or space sperated string
JIRA: RELENG-344
Change-Id: I8e4b37fc476f39e10321755f1e67fe3605178406
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
Change-Id: I13bd62699c14bb504751b2e1149de0812b771ba0
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
|
|
|
|
Do not allow to delete pods which are associated
with test-results
JIRA: RELENG-350
Change-Id: I8cb306d719acebff257048f08bcb981d81c64513
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
Add the name of the insatllers, versions, projects
and customs in the delete confirm modal
add tests
Change-Id: I91e115f484726d98c357de844197189b22f66584
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
|
|
Show the results in sorted order
Provide options to sort the results by name,
role, mode
Change-Id: I8b514769e9b878a0ff4bafcae8e909af3284f7ca
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
|
|
|
|
|
|
upload result file is used by dovetail, since now dovetail has
leveraged its own cvp repo, and TestAPI is mostly and should be
used as a realtime results collecting, no need to keep such function.
Change-Id: Ibd56035d5d63020e224a382c8040705f63b63386
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
Change-Id: Ide0e00e3aa6ee4a484fd9d1b7c9bc52b598267ea
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
|
|
Prevent user from deleting or updating projects
which are associated with testcases
JIRA: RELENG-335
JIRA: RELENG-336
Change-Id: Ic0a8841a4632329f4b58aeb97cb93a91bacc2b06
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
Cover the deploy result get one function & not found in
unit test
JIRA: RELENG-345
Change-Id: I45e9c9c4feacc73d2c934031656ac063be42a148
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
implement function to add multiple customs with
a single add button click
JIRA: RELENG-344
Change-Id: I7c4ac409ee5d78a6a01b242368b02813f0df400f
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
|
|
Create view and controller for deploy results
Add tests for deploy results
Change-Id: Iba29e7a867d45aacd18a26dc4e2d9363cdf8928d
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
|
|
Change Owner to creator in pod, projects
Add creator in testCase, scenarios
Fix issue in e2e testing
Change-Id: Ib520eb107dce2ed8fc6fd390f034f500bf4c742a
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
filter suggestions in results page
fix ui in results page
Change-Id: Id0eebd9575b5f494061130afe2c7d42c74985cec
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
design scenario create method in modal way.
design scenario page.
Add,delete for installers,versions, projects and customs
are implemented.
tests are added.
1. Pods page
2. project page
3. Scenarios
4. Scenario
Change-Id: Ice26af77ec3d5fe874cf5c2062f208072dea289f
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
|
|
design scenario create method in modal way.
design scenario page.
Add,delete for installers,versions, projects, customs, trust
indicators and scores are implemented.
tests are not included. validations are not added.
Change-Id: I999229c00869fcd5a4efa97cb2679a08fc24b271
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
Add links for the redirection
Created Result page
Change-Id: I7ba80f6a8d774d6fde33280f701c1188cb5c32d9
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
|
|
Change-Id: I1efd519f877d48499dcd98a420b90a1b5d4c488f
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
Change-Id: If1d1e3e22be0ddbb92f0e3b927ea4e376f0a8c89
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
Change-Id: Ibc5066f721b6b3343c2f8cb4ec0b9234960e9cb6
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
Change-Id: I038078ada94dc103b625fa77d6f7fc7e214c8dd7
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
|
|
|
|
Change-Id: I5fe50c44e7b36ea45dd1b8632130b30dfe173d0a
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
name query is case insensitive and partial match
Change-Id: I65a6f5d3aa9411559cb9cf27d0fbd7ec46d4b26f
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
apply multiple filter in results page.
Add e2e tests for results page.
Change-Id: Ia55407d921136756ab5f15507c92775f95a761dc
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
|
|
Created the testcases, testcase pages
Remove update, delete buttons in project page.
add protractor tests for testcases page.
change tabs to spaces
Change-Id: Id7d381b13dca4f228bda24fa1abad7c465b5cef7
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
Change-Id: I3ea4ea202bf2f5cf17ca585ccffbef3265ef7cc0
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
Implemented the filter option for the projects by
following params.
name - Check the project's name.
Edit the Error message view.
Change-Id: Ib2f0e0ccd9726353dbbedbc44d98747ec8e2d4f9
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
Edit the response from the server and remove the
traceback part from the error response.
Add create success alert.
Change-Id: I887a9ca1b55050d961c6db1141c15203a978aec1
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
Implemented the update and delete functions for the
projects and wrote the e2e tests for the both
functions.
Change-Id: I917dd9503f145b0dde61dd9970bd855f9711335e
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
Implemented the create function for the projects.
Wrote the e2e tests for the create function.
Change-Id: Iceac650573ca31b6246350c4d60033b42e0ffb0f
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
Change-Id: I9baa04ff062f36569c1e143014239931de64cf32
Signed-off-by: thuva4 <tharma.thuva@gmail.com>
|
|
divide resources into handlers&models
put ui handlers into handlers directory
put User into user_models.py
Change-Id: I3d9e260097205213c3ea8d4eac08b9019e017f71
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
|
|
in local deployment situation, authentication can be disabled by
setting authenticate=False of ui section in config.ini
JIRA: RELENG-324
Change-Id: I9157d1723851feb12435033dbdd59035e3eb5777
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|
|
criteria must be fix with 'PASS/FAIL', case insensitive
or else, BADREQUEST exception will be raises
JIRA: RELENG-327
Change-Id: Ic648b9d38937fc63924e42cfdf5345cdaa32e1ed
Signed-off-by: SerenaFeng <feng.xiaowei@zte.com.cn>
|